## Ownership

The fleet fuel-usage report is generated nightly by the Haulstone pipeline and published to the Greenmarsh dashboard. Schema changes require a migration note in this repo, and any change to the litres-per-route calculation needs a review from the analytics guild. For the weekly eng sync, updates and open issues on this report are presented by:

named custodian: Belius Casath Ulaix Sorius

Hello team,

As part of our quarterly security cycle, we are rotating the service key used by Wayfinder, our address autocomplete widget, to reach the internal Gazetteer lookup service. The previous key will stop working this Friday at noon. Please update your local development environment before then, otherwise suggestion dropdowns will silently return empty results, which is confusing to debug. Full rotation steps are in the runbook. For convenience, the new key is included below.

service key, tadup-tahog: zpat7_wB1tnEL

Handover: Pinecrest firmware update channel

To the release manager — I'm rotating off the Pinecrest device team this week, so here's the state of the firmware channel. The stable ring is frozen at build 4.8; beta ring gets nightly pushes from the Oakline signer. Rollback images are staged but unsigned — don't promote anything until QA clears the bootloader fix. The channel signing vault re-locks every 24 hours by policy. If you need to push before Friday, unseal it with the passphrase below.

vault phrase of tajeg-tageg = pelix-druix-holius-briael-zorwyn-frawyn-fraox-norok-drueth-aldiel

Meeting notes — sealed exam-paper run (excerpt)

Attendees: ops lead, security, warehouse. Decisions: Bramleigh Institute exam cartons stay in the locked cage until dispatch morning. Seals checked twice — at cage and at loading. One vehicle, no mixed load. Receiving contact at the Institute signs seal log on arrival; any broken seal means immediate return, no exceptions. Shift lead owns the chain-of-custody sheet end to end. Final point minuted: the courier hand-over instruction below is confidential — verbal briefing only.

handover note for yagef-bagep: the drudor pelius courier leaves the kasdor zorvan norir ledger at gate 8016 under passcode 755406